Bromley Cross (Lancs) simplifies your travel with essential amenities. For ticketing, the station is equipped with accessible ticket machines, making it easy to collect tickets purchased online. A helpful induction loop is available for those needing auditory assistance. Although the station itself isn't staffed around the clock, customer help points ensure assistance is available when you need it most. Car park users will find the space open 24 hours with over 70 spaces available, an added benefit being free parking.
Accessibility is given considerable attention. Though there aren't accessible toilets or set-down/pick-up points specifically marked for impaired mobility, the station provides step-free access to certain areas, ensuring a smoother experience for passengers with limited mobility. Unfortunately, basic facilities like refreshment kiosks, ATMs, or shops are absent, so be sure to bring anything you'll need with you before arriving.
Traveling onward from Bromley Cross is straightforward. The station's transport connections include a rail replacement service, conveniently located at a nearby bus stop opposite the Railway Pub. For taxi services, details are available online through a convenient link, ensuring a seamless continuation of your journey. Bus services offer another viable option, with planning information accessible via a printable poster from National Rail. While there isn’t an underground or metro service available directly, Greater Manchester’s transport service can be contacted for wider metro plans at 0161 228 7811.

Gillingham (Kent) Train Station offers a range of facilities to make your journey more enjoyable. The ticket office is open from early morning until late in the evening, with automated machines available for collecting tickets purchased online. The station is fully accessible with step-free access throughout, making it convenient for passengers using wheelchairs or those with mobility impairments. Though there is no waiting room, a seating area is available.
For your comfort, the station provides accessible toilets and baby-changing facilities located on platforms 1/2 and 3. Refreshments are easy to find with a coffee shop and vending machines on-site. An ATM is conveniently located outside the main entrance for any last-minute cash needs.
Gillingham (Kent) is well-connected with various transport options to ensure a smooth transition from train to your final destination. Local taxi services are easily accessible from the side of the station on Railway Street. Bus services are also conveniently reachable, with further information available here to help you plan your onward travel.
In the event of rail disruptions, a rail replacement service operates from the side entrance to platform 3, providing continuity in your travel plans.
